Semi-Finals Game 1: St.Francis X. - Alberta 83-91

Date: March 10, 2012
The game without a history. Golden Bears led from the first minutes and controlled entire game increasing their lead in each quarter. They made 18-of-21 charity shots (85.7 percent) during the game. Swingman Daniel Ferguson (191, college: Valdosta St.) nailed 31 points and 6 rebounds for the winning side and international guard Jordan Baker (192-91, college: Utah Valley) accounted for 20 points, 9 rebounds and 7 assists. Guard Terry Thomas (193) came up with a double-double by scoring 22 points and 10 rebounds and forward Jeremy Dunn (198) added 21 points and 5 rebounds respectively for X-Men in the defeat.
